What is a Deep Freezer Chest?
A deep freezer chest is a type of freezer that is typically larger and has a greater storage capability than basic upright freezers. Unlike upright models that are more vertically oriented, chest freezers are larger and deeper, permitting more efficient storage of bulk items such as meats, bulk produce, or prepared meals.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How do I select the best size chest freezer for my requirements?
To pick the ideal size, consider your family size and food storage needs. A basic guideline is to assign about 1.5 cubic feet of freezer area per person in your household. However, larger households or those who buy in bulk might require more area.
2. Can I keep a deep freezer in an unheated garage?
Yes, however it depends on the freezer's temperature ranges. Some designs are particularly developed for usage in unheated areas, while others need to be kept in climate-controlled environments.
3. How often should I defrost a chest freezer?
It depends upon the design, but usually, a chest freezer must be defrosted when the frost accumulation goes beyond a quarter of an inch. This will assist maintain efficiency and efficiency.
4. What is the average lifespan of a chest freezer?
Most chest freezers have an average lifespan of about 10 to 20 years, depending on usage and maintenance.
5. Can I freeze all types of food in a chest freezer?
While most food types freeze well, some products have specific requirements. For instance, dairy products, products with high water content (like fresh vegetables and fruits), and certain pastries might require specific preparation before freezing.

Preserving Your Deep Freezer Chest
To guarantee the durability and effectiveness of your deep freezer, follow these upkeep tips:

Clean Regularly: Wipe down interiors and exteriors consistently to avoid buildup and keep the unit functioning optimally.

Check Seals: Regularly examine the door seals to maintain airtight closures.

Keep it Full: Keeping your freezer full can help preserve temperature level stability; think about filling voids with bottles of water if required.

Keep a Thermometer Inside: To monitor the internal temperature level, which ought to be at or listed below 0 ° F (-18 ° C) for optimum food conservation.

Defrost When Necessary: Regularly thaw if not utilizing a frost-free model to keep efficiency.
